Leaders in Camp

All packs must have at least one adult for every five Webelos attending. A registered leader 
is r
equired for every pack attending.  Other adults attending may be parents.

Every pack that attends must be under the supervision of its own adult leadership at all times. According to the BSA youth protection policy, two-deep leadership is required for all activities, one leader who is at least 21 years of age and a second who is 18 years of age or older.  

You are in charge of your pack at all times and r
esponsible for the discipline and organization of your pack.  It is never the camp staff’s task to take over your role as leader of your unit.
